SpearID FIDO2 works almost everywhere

SpearID FIDO2 is a certified identification key according to the FIDO standard. The number of supported online services and applications is growing all the time. In addition to FIDO-supported services, the SpearID FIDO2 key also supports other general two-part identification services. See the list of supported services below.

What should I do if I lose my security key?

Having two FIDO keys is recommended. You can register more than one key for one user, so if one key fails, you can use the other. www 7 movie verified

Technical Specifications

  • Supported operating systems: Windows, macOS, Linux, Android, IOS
  • Supported browsers: Edge, Chrome, Firefox, Opera, Safari
  • Supported functions: FIDO U2F, FIDO2, OATH TOTP et HOTP
  • Security algorithms: HA256, AES, HMAC, ECDH, ECDSA
  • Key dimensions: 44,7x16x9 (mm)
  • Supported protocols: CTAPHID, Clavier HID, CCID, NFC, BLE
  • Manufacturing materials: aluminium, polycarbonate
  • Certifications: FIDO2 L1, CE, FCC, RoHS, WEEE
